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.

test-assets sc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 2d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

test-assets
The test-data umbrella for robium. Every smoke, regression, or policy-eval
test consumes data (a world to load, a robot model to spawn, a dataset slice
to train on, a bag to replay, a golden to diff against), and picking those
assets ad hoc produces unrecognizable, irreproducible fixtures. This skill
owns which canonical assets to test against for a given robot type, the
standard test-assets folder layout with its provenance manifest, and the
sourcing decision (pointer vs vendored). It does not own the test pyramid and
pass bars (testing), training-data sourcing strategy (data), simulator
selection rationale (simulation), or asset loading/spawning mechanics
(gazebo, isaac-sim).
When to use this skill
- Setting up test data for any new robotics project; load together with
testing: that skill decides which pyramid layers to build; this one supplies the data those layers run against. - The trigger phrases in the description: 'test assets', 'test world', 'test fixture', 'download a test dataset', 'sample rosbag', 'which world should I test in', 'golden output', 'regression fixture'.
- Choosing a world, robot model, or sample dataset for a smoke or regression test, including "we should own copies of these" vendoring decisions.
